Q: Is 29,592,214 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 29,592,214 is a composite number.

Why is 29,592,214 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 29,592,214 can be evenly divided by 1 2 23 46 113 226 2,599 5,198 5,693 11,386 130,939 261,878 643,309 1,286,618 14,796,107 and 29,592,214, with no remainder.

Since 29,592,214 cannot be divided by just 1 and 29,592,214, it is a composite number.
